M

LeadsourCe - Top-Rated B2B Lead Generation Company...

LeadsourCe - Top-Rated B2B Lead Generation Company is simply the best! 💯 Their services have exceeded my expectations and helped my business grow significantly. Highly recommended! 👍

Comments:

No comments